April 01, 2021A Chattanooga Vision For Community Land TrustsAs the real estate market soars here in Chattanooga, one possible solution to the lack of affordable housing - especially downtown - is a community land trust. It’s a model that would help people with low-to-moderate incomes buy into affordable housing - and now, a report details how that model could work citywide....more10minPlay

March 31, 2021A New Space For Women Leaders In ChattanoogaFor 25 years, the Chattanooga Women’s Leadership Institute has elevated the role and influence of professional women in this area’s business and civic sectors. Soon, the nonprofit will open a new headquarters and coworking space on the third floor of the Chattanooga Area Chamber of Commerce on Broad Street....more9minPlay
